About Coward, South Carolina

Coward is a locality in Florence County, South Carolina, United States. It is a small community with a population of 748. The population density is 81.8 people per km². Coward is located at 33.9732°N, 79.7470°W. It observes the Eastern Time (America/New_York) timezone. Coward is an incorporated locality. ZIP code: 29530.

It lies 15.4 miles south of Florence, SC (from Florence, SC: bearing 177°T), and is situated 7.1 miles north of Lake City.
